Renaming Interns and Supporting Telehealth for Private Practice Interns
SB 122, which would rename registered mental health counselor interns as "registered associate mental health counselors" as well as remove a line in the statute that requires registered interns in private practice settings to have licensed mental health professionals on the premises when while providing clinical services, was filed on 12/20/24. A companion bill will likely be filed in the House shortly.
LMHCs and Educational and Disability-Related Evaluations
A GRC subcommittee is exploring potential action related to adding counselors to a list of professionals who can offer ESE evaluations for the schools. That subcommittee is also exploring potential action related to recommending that Florida’s Division of Vocational Rehabilitation revise a policy that prohibits it’s employees from using a diagnosis provided by a LMHC, LCSW, or LMFT who is not supervised by a psychologist or physician.
Advocating for a Testing Rule
The GRC Chair addressed the 491 Board during it’s meeting on 12/4 in Tampa to read FMHCA’s recommendation to create a rule for 491 Board licensees that is similar to a rule for psychologists about the release of testing materials, answered questions from board members and legal counsel, and offered follow-up information about fair and equal access to tests. The Board's attorney committed to conducting some research related to this request, and an update may be available at the next 491 Board meeting on 2/6/25.
Advocating for MHCs who Provide Forensic Evaluation and Expert Witness Testimony
SMHCA's partner, the National Board of Forensic Evaluators (NBFE), is collecting data to support judicial circuits that are trying to reduce wait times for certain types of forensic evaluations by appointing qualified MHCs for those evaluations. FMHCA's GRC is searching for a criminal justice bill that might be amended to revise a statute that fails to list 491 licensees as professionals who the court can appoint to conduct certain types of evaluations.
